A long time: The bald patches vary from day to day and month to month and in different areas of the tongue. Generally it lasts years and may never fully go away. The good news is that it is benign and harmless without any need to treat. Some patients may experience sensitivity to spicy or other foods and then need to limit those foods accordingly.

Unknown: The good thing about geographic tongue is that it is completely harmless. Unfortunately there is no treatment for it. It will resolve spontaneously, but this may take months to years. Avoid irritating foods such as pineapple or citrus fruits.
